Learning Disability nursing students:

The RCN has placed high priority on capturing the views of nursing students who are about to begin the 3rd year of their studies into LD nursing. During August and September 2011 calls for expressions of interest in participating were sent and we are delighted that a good number of you have from all corners of the U.K.

During the autumn we will be sending out a short series of questions within a survey to gather views and repeating this at 6 monthly intervals. We hope that the data we collect will be invaluable in helping us to better understand how and why nurses choose LD nursing, what their experiences are and what the reality of their first permanent employment is in the future.

The Image and Reality of Learning Disability Nursing:

We are very excited to have successfully bid for RCN resources to develop a DVD resource which will illustrate both the positive image and reality of LD nursing. We hope to capture the diverse roles that LD nurses have, in a broad range of areas, together with the views of carers and service users for the positive impact that LD nurses offer.

We hope to launch our resource during RCN Congress 2012 and in the coming few months will be working with an appointed production team, with members and with other stakeholders.
